One of the greatest challenges in bulk agricultural testing is sample heterogeneity. A small sample cup often fails to represent a multi-ton truckload of grain accurately, leading to sampling errors and inaccurate grading.
TheIAS-5100 analyzer addresses this fundamental challenge by incorporating an innovative large-area scanning mode.
● Broader Sample Coverage: By illuminating and scanning a significantly larger surface area in a single measurement, the instrument captures natural variations within the crop batch.
● Superior Spectral Quality: Averaging data across a larger footprint yields higher-quality spectra, minimizing the noise associated with localized kernel size or color anomalies.
● Representative Batch Analysis: This capability facilitates comprehensive batch analysis, drastically reducing the manpower needed for repetitive sub-sampling while drastically increasing total sample throughput.
Agricultural commodities are highly dynamic; moisture levels fluctuate rapidly with morning dew, drying processes, and ambient humidity. Waiting 24 hours for laboratory assays is no longer viable in a high-speed supply chain.
The IAS-5100 instrument supports daily operational workflows by tracking sample quality in real-time. Because the testing data provided by the IAS-5100 analyzer remains consistently reliable even for fast-changing samples, grain traders and quality managers can instantly optimize:
● Pricing and Grading: Paying fair market value based on immediate protein and moisture metrics.
● Drier Optimization: Adjusting industrial grain dryers dynamically to prevent over-drying or spoilage.
● Bin Segregation: Routing high-protein or premium-grade grains to specialized silos automatically.
